Thugs storm SDP meeting in Ilorin, brutalize party members

Date: 2022-05-19

Over 20 unidentified political thugs on Wednesday stormed the Labour House beside the state High Court Complex in Ilorin, Kwara State to disrupt a political function organised by the Social Democratic Party, SDP.

Members of a faction of the Social Democratic Party (SDP) in the state, were holding a press conference when the thugs invaded the labour house.

The political thugs forced their way into the Labour House owned by the state chapter of the Nigeria Labour Congress (NLC) and descended heavily on the conveners of the meeting.

The factional chairman of the SDP in the Ifelodun local government area of the state, Elder James Olajide, was manhandled, his cloth torn, his cap seized and dragged on the bare floor by the thugs.

The angry thugs kept shouting at the man, “Baba Ifelodun, why did you take money from AA to disrupt our party”.

The thugs also rough handled, abducted and chased away an elderly man who was walking with the aid of a stick.

The Publicity Secretary of a faction of the SDP, Kareem Akanbi, had on Tuesday, announced the suspension of eight members from the party, signalling a leadership crisis within the party.

The conveners of the Wednesday meeting included some of the people that were suspended for alleged anti-party activities.

Before the disruption of the press conference at the Labour House, the factional chairman of the SDP (original), Ibrahim Yahaya, had alleged plans by some former members of the All Progressives Congress (APC) who recently joined the party, to hijack it from the pioneer executives of the party.

“It is no longer news that a faction of the All Progressives Congress party in Kwara State (APC Loyal) formally applied to join our party, the SDP vide a letter to SDP National Secretariat dated 9th March 2022 by a reply letter dated 11th March 2022.

“The national secretariat of the SDP acknowledged the APC Loyal letter and their intention to join the SDP in Kwara State with a promise to work on a harmonization arrangement on how their interests will be accommodated.”

He said while the original SDP members in Kwara State under his leadership were waiting for further directives from the national secretariat, “we were shocked to hear about a purported state congress of Kwara SDP held on 26th April 2022 which was stage-managed by the Kwara APC Loyal group in collaboration with some officials of the SDP national secretariat.

“The sole aim of the kangaroo state congress election of SDP on 26th April 2022, was to hijack the party (SDP) from the original members of the party who had worked tirelessly to bring the party to its enviable position in Kwara State.

“The said congress was held in contravention of the SDP constitution. Also, the original members of Kwara SDP were denied participation in the said congress contrary to the relevant provisions of the Electoral Act 2022.

The embattled factional chairman informed that he had protested the said purported state congress of Kwara SDP held on 26th April 2022 at the Kwara APC Loyal group to the National Secretariat of the party.

“Also, we have instructed our team of lawyers who have since swung into action to challenge in the law court the legality of the purported state congress of the Kwara SDP held on 26th April 2022,” Yahaya stated.
